🏆 Expert Verdict & Overview
Car Racing 3D: Racer Master positions itself as a high-octane, accessible entry in the mobile racing landscape, catering specifically to fans of stunt-based arcade driving. While the market is saturated with realistic simulators, this title carves out its niche by prioritizing immediate "pick-up-and-play" mechanics and robust offline functionality. As a Senior Analyst, I find that Car Racing 3D: Racer Master successfully balances the thrill of speed with low-barrier entry requirements, making it a versatile option for gamers who value convenience and variety over hardcore technical simulation.
🔍 Key Features Breakdown
- Diverse Stunt Environments: By offering varied locales such as Ice World, deserts, and seaside tracks, the game solves the common issue of visual fatigue, keeping the racing experience fresh across different levels.
- Comprehensive Offline Mode: This feature addresses a major pain point for mobile users—unreliable connectivity. It ensures that the core gameplay loop is available during commutes or in areas without Wi-Fi.
- Progression and Upgrade System: The ability to collect props and upgrade sports cars provides a necessary sense of growth, solving the problem of stagnant gameplay by giving players tangible goals to work toward.
- Intuitive Control Scheme: Designed for mobile ergonomics, the simplified controls allow users to perform complex drifts and dodges without the steep learning curve found in more complex racing simulators.

⚖️ Pros & Cons Analysis
- ✅ The Good: Exceptional accessibility with a low performance overhead, making it playable on a wide range of Android devices.
- ✅ The Good: Strong variety in track design and environmental hazards that challenge a player's reflexes.
- ❌ The Bad: The current lack of a real-time multiplayer mode limits the competitive depth for high-skill players.
- ❌ The Bad: Sound effects can feel repetitive during longer play sessions, occasionally detracting from the immersion.
🛠️ Room for Improvement
To elevate the experience to a premium tier, the developers should prioritize the promised "World Ranking" and "Multiplayer" modes to foster a community-driven environment. Additionally, refining the physics engine to provide more weight to the vehicles during jumps would enhance the "Racer Master" feel. Introducing more unique car archetypes—perhaps off-road or classic muscle cars—would also add much-needed depth to the garage customization system.
